Drive shaft
I. Overview
(I) Structure summary
Drive shaft is located above the front sub frame and combined with left drive shaft assembly and right
drive shaft assembly, who transmit the transmission output torque and speed to the wheels. The inside of
the drive shaft is connected to gearbox differential by spline, by the inside universal joints can slide
axially inside the steering wheel in order to compensate for the change in length caused by turning and
jitter; through the outer universal joint it can have a large rotation angle and through a spline at the end of
the shaft, connect hub inner ring and lock with self-locking nuts.

(IV) Maintenance parameters
Drive shaft
Item outside inside
Drive shaft universal joint type GI AC
maximum allowable angle 23° 45°
Lubrication grease
Item Lubrication grease quantity
Drive shaft GI GRBN-1000 120±10g
AC CVJM-2008J 120±10g

(III) Check
1. Check all parts of the drive shaft
1) Check whether there is damage on left and right drive
shaft splines.
2) Check whether there is damage around the drive shaft
dust cover or securely installed.
3) Check whether there is clamp damage or missing on
the moving ends of the left and right shaft.
4) Universal joint should be able to ride in any direction
around the drive shaft.
